§ 01 · Modus Operandi

How the scam operates.

ProDivia Group presents itself as an investment or trading platform, targeting retail investors by anchoring its marketing to a United Kingdom registration claim. The United Kingdom carries considerable credibility as a financial centre, and the invocation of that jurisdiction is a deliberate positioning choice. Nothing in the platform's public-facing material, however, is supported by verifiable regulatory documentation.

The operational mechanics follow a pattern well-documented among unauthorised brokers. The platform provides no regulatory disclosures of any kind, and a review of the Financial Conduct Authority's official register returns no record of ProDivia Group or any associated entity. Without FCA authorisation, the operator is subject to none of the conduct requirements governing client money segregation, complaint handling, or capital adequacy. Investors who engage the platform do so entirely outside any recognised compensation or dispute framework.

The point of failure surfaces when a user attempts to recover deposited capital. Withdrawal requests encounter delays, shifting pretexts, or silence. The absence of a regulated entity to complain to becomes the defining practical consequence. § 02 · Identifying Signals

Red flags we documented.

  • 01
    Claimed UK Registration With No FCA Record
    ProDivia Group states it is registered in the United Kingdom, yet no corresponding entry exists in the Financial Conduct Authority's public register. Regulated UK investment firms must be authorised or registered with the FCA. The absence of any record is not a clerical gap; it indicates the operation is functioning entirely outside the regulatory perimeter.
  • 02
    No Regulatory Disclosures of Any Kind
    A regulated investment platform is required to publish its authorisation number, registered address, and applicable regulatory framework. ProDivia Group provides none of these. The omission makes independent verification of any licensing claim impossible and is itself a disqualifying signal.
  • 03
    Unauthorised Operation in a Regulated Jurisdiction
    Soliciting investment business from UK clients without FCA authorisation breaches the Financial Services and Markets Act. Investors dealing with such operators have no access to the Financial Services Compensation Scheme and face severe limitations on formal complaints routes.

My deposits keep showing profit but I cannot withdraw from ProDivia Group. Is the platform real? +
A platform that displays growing balances but blocks withdrawals is the most common fake-broker pattern. The "profit" exists only as a number in the operator's database — no real trades happened.
